Weighted power counting and Lorentz violating gauge theories. II: Classification

ANSELMI, DAMIANO
2009-01-01

Abstract

We classify the local, polynomial, unitary gauge theories that violate Lorentz symmetry explicitly at high energies and are renormalizable by weighted power counting. We study the structure of such theories and prove that renormalization does not generate higher time derivatives. We work out the conditions to renormalize vertices that are usually non-renormalizable, such as the two scalar-two fermion interactions and the four fermion interactions. A number of four-dimensional examples are presented. (C) 2008 Elsevier Inc. All rights reserved.
